First new type of malaria treatment in decadesAfter successful clinical trials, the first new type of malaria treatment in decades is to seek regulatory approval. GanLum, from pharma company Novartis, outperformed the standard treatment by demonstrating a cure rate of 99.2% compared with 96.7% from the standard treatment. Crucially, it should also be effective against malaria parasites that have developed resistance to artemisinin — a component of the current standard treatment. In the 1990s, resistance to chloroquine, then the standard malaria treatment, led to millions of deaths, says Dr George Jagoe of the Medicines for Malaria Venture.

The traditional Peard Cup final took place on St Stephen’s Day at Garryduff, with C of I B facing Bandon. The tempo lifted in the second quarter, and the first real opportunity of the match fell to James Taylor, whose shot drifted wide of the target. A C of I B short corner was initially cleared, but during the second phase a shot was blocked on its way to goal, resulting in a penalty stroke. Bandon pressed hard in the final quarter and were rewarded with five minutes remaining when Ali Smith converted a penalty stroke following a last-ditch, mistimed challenge. However, C of I B held their nerve in the closing moments to secure a deserved 2–1 victory to claim the Peard Cup.

The widespread frost is expected in the final nights of 2025. Photo: Damien StoranThe final days of 2025 will stay “cool, cloudy and dry”, Met Éireann has said, but the nights are expected to bring temperatures below freezing and widespread frost. However, it will remain less cold near eastern coasts, with temperatures between 4 and 7C. Sunday night will be dry and cloudy, with the chance of isolated drizzle patches in the east and south. “And it will be cold by night with temperatures widely falling below freezing and widespread frost developing.
